2011-02-28 67 views

回答

1

這可能是一個通用的瀏覽器緩存問題。 您可以通過設置一些無緩存頭來強制瀏覽器在點擊後退按鈕時重新加載頁面。

你可以試試這個方法:(快速谷歌搜索後發現,你可能會想更深入)

http://blog.serendeputy.com/posts/how-to-prevent-browsers-from-caching-a-page-in-rails/

+0

大聲笑,我提交了這個答案後我看到你實際上在幾秒鐘前結束了同一篇文章。 – 2011-02-28 13:47:54

15

你可以使用

flash.now 

這裏有一個拇指規則。

In your controller, use flash when you're redirecting and flash.now when rendering. 
+0

在我重定向的具體情況 - 從顯示視圖索引。我的問題是,在離開含有閃光燈信息的頁面後,是否可以刪除閃光信息,然後單擊「返回」按鈕。 – 2011-02-28 13:39:10

+0

我發現在這個stackoverflow線程,這是相關的緩存:http://stackoverflow.com/questions/711418/how-to-prevent-browser-page-caching-in-rails – 2011-02-28 13:46:00

相關問題